Automation (beyond "Like rabbits" simulation mode) is still a bit rough and definitely something I'll continue to refine. You wouldn't believe how hard it was to actually get them to start to grow each system exponentially. There is no AI built into in the game itself, just hard-coded logic, so giving something the appearance of autonomy has proven to be one of the most challenging aspects of this game by far. Especially as I add more feature, as each time it requires updating the progression logic of the autonomous modes.
As for your point about resource abundance, I agree completely and already have several plans to address this, including megaprojects!
The game in it's current state (build v25) represents a framework that I've purpose built to be expanded upon. The current iteration essentially showcases only 1 of 3 core gameplay phases I have in mind for this project.
Phase 1) Explore and Expand (current game)
Phase 2) Entrench and Exploit (current game+, this is where those massive resource stockpiles start to do something...)
Phase 3) Collapse and Conquest (every utopia can only last so long...)
Yes! I have several plans for this aspect of the game as it's currently underutilized.
I'd like to include randomly seeded "alien ruins" across the map. Once discovered in a system, the instance in charge there will be given the option to begin a new megaproject (exotic research, or something similar). Completing this project will consume A LOT of time and resources, particularly compute and energy, but once completed it will grant a predetermined bonus or benefit. Still brainstorming what those benefits will be exactly, but they will be huge and worth the resource investment.
